Good Script Decides My Involvement In A Film, Says Aamir KhanFor Bollywood actor, Aamir Khan, a good screenplay decides his participation in a film project as an actor or maker.

Presently, the actor is promoting his latest production-'Peepli Live'- whose screenplay by first time director, Anusha Rizvi, he read three-four years back.

Mr. Perfectionist said, ''I only act or produce in scripts that my heart goes out for, and don't look into the production value. Taking - ''Rang de Basanti'' as case- four films on Bhagat Singh had already been made, but we still went ahead. The actor has not signed any offers including one from Danny Boyle, and is focusing on promoting his latest film- ''Peepli Live'' produced by him. The film is a satirical take on the issue of farmers' suicide in rural India.

''The selling point of Peepli Live are strong script by director Anusha Rizvi and co-director Mehmood, and an excellent cast from Nabeeb Sahab's theatre company. It's their first time in front of a camera, but their performance is better than any of mine, and I have been in the industry for 20 years,'' Khan added.

Aamir is not only happy with the aesthetic and production of the movie, which is set for August 23 release, but is also sensitively touched by the subject.

''The film has sensitized me about the plight of our countrymen in rural India. When you read or watch something that connects with you emotionally, it sensitizes you. The film is neither negative nor judgmental. It shows how all of us are- as human beings'' he said. (With Inputs from Agencies)
